Diary Transcription:

microfilm: begin page 713

Monday, July 4, 1938 (continued)

(3) G 4741 (continued)
G 4741 C: In shaft. South of B. Lined with crude brick. Ends at rock. Total depth 1.05 meters. Sand and dirty debris. Ends at rock. No chamber. Type 7x.

Sketch of G 4741 and G 4742.

[ILLUSTRATION]

(5) G 4742
G 4742 A: In shaft and chamber. North of G 4741. Cut in rock. No lining preserved. Total depth 2.1 meters. Sand, some stones and traces of bones. Chamber on west. Cut in rock. No blocking. Cleared. Drawing.

[ILLUSTRATION]

(4) G 4722
G 4722 F: Removed the chamber blocking. Stones, rubble and traces of mud. In the chamber. Body, head on east and underneath the body stones and rubble. Body left for photo.
